About the Program

The Careers in Sustainability program is a non-degree course that introduces students to careers in sustainability, focusing on the role of a sustainability analyst. It's offered by Arizona State University, taught in English, and can be completed online. The program provides students with knowledge of sustainability and practical skills to apply in their careers.

The curriculum includes video, print, peer review, and interactive content, allowing students to practice what they learn and receive feedback from peers. The course covers topics like sustainability, professional writing, presentation skills, and conducting successful video meetings. Students will develop skills in areas like sustainability analysis, professional communication, and problem-solving.

After completing this program, students can pursue careers as sustainability analysts, environmental consultants, corporate social responsibility managers, sustainability specialists, or renewable energy consultants. They can work in industries such as energy, government, or non-profit, with employers like the Environmental Protection Agency, Patagonia, or the Nature Conservancy.
